The breakfasts were good, with ample choice to cover all dietary needs. The hotel had a relaxed atmosphere but beware, there are numerous steep steps and the hot water is very very hot.

I consider this property a trade off of sorts. The location and staff were great. The views were stunning from each of the rooms. However, other travelers may want to be warned of the "stair" situation. My room was located at the very bottom of the property--- 165 steps from the bottom to the street level. In addition, the rooms themselves were "youth hostile-like" at best with probably the WORST mattress I've ever slept on. The amenities were sporadic at best. One day I didn't get towels....the next I got towels but no toiletries. The staff was accommodating an brought me both when asked, but the facilities themselves were just tired, towels were frayed, and as I mentioned, the bed was awful. Staff was friendly and nice and I give the porters huge kudos given they carried our luggage up and down the stairs.....which was a miserable hike up and down the stairs.
